CSL05D BK Equivalent & Substitute Parts

Part Overview

The CSL05D BK is a 5V Zener Transient Voltage Suppressor (TVS) diode manufactured by Central Semiconductor Corp, designed for surface mount applications in SOT-23 packaging. This bidirectional TVS diode provides transient overvoltage protection with a 12V clamping voltage and 17A peak pulse current rating (8/20µs).

The CSL05D BK is classified as obsolete. Identifying equivalent substitute parts is necessary to maintain design continuity and ensure component availability for new production runs, repairs, and system upgrades.

Substitute Part Grouping Explanation

Substitution of the CSL05D BK is determined by the following critical electrical and mechanical parameters:

  • Voltage - Reverse Standoff: 5V nominal rating
  • Voltage - Breakdown (Min): 6V or higher
  • Voltage - Clamping (Max) @ Ipp: Must not exceed 12V to maintain circuit protection integrity
  • Current - Peak Pulse (10/1000µs): 17A minimum to handle transient events
  • Package / Case: SOT-23-3 (TO-236) for mechanical and thermal compatibility
  • Mounting Type: Surface Mount for PCB integration

The SM05T1G from onsemi meets these substitution criteria with compatible electrical characteristics and identical package specifications.

Engineering Selection Recommendations

The SM05T1G is a direct functional substitute for the obsolete CSL05D BK. Both devices share identical package specifications (SOT-23-3), peak pulse current ratings (17A at 8/20µs), and moisture sensitivity classifications.

The SM05T1G offers the following advantages for new designs and production:

  • Active product status ensures long-term availability and supply chain stability
  • ROHS3 compliance meets current environmental and regulatory requirements
  • Extended operating temperature range (-55°C ~ 150°C) provides broader thermal performance
  • Lower clamping voltage (9.8V vs. 12V) delivers improved transient suppression efficiency

The SM05T1G is suitable for direct replacement in applications where the CSL05D BK was originally specified, provided circuit design parameters accommodate the lower clamping voltage and reduced peak pulse power rating (300W vs. 400W).

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can the SM05T1G directly replace the CSL05D BK in existing designs?

A: Yes. Both devices share identical SOT-23-3 package specifications, reverse standoff voltage (5V), breakdown voltage (6V minimum), and peak pulse current (17A). The SM05T1G's lower clamping voltage (9.8V) provides enhanced protection margins in most applications.

Q: What is the difference between bidirectional and unidirectional TVS diodes?

A: The CSL05D BK is bidirectional (protects both positive and negative transients), while the SM05T1G is unidirectional (protects in one direction only). Circuit topology determines which configuration is required. Verify your application's protection requirements before substitution.

Q: Does the lower peak pulse power rating of the SM05T1G affect compatibility?

A: The SM05T1G's 300W peak pulse power rating is lower than the CSL05D BK's 400W rating. Applications with transient energy levels below 300W are fully compatible. For applications requiring the full 400W capacity, verify that transient energy does not exceed the SM05T1G specification.

Q: Are there any compliance or certification differences?

A: The SM05T1G carries ROHS3 compliance certification, meeting current environmental standards. Both devices share identical MSL ratings (1 - Unlimited) and ECCN classifications (EAR99).

Q: What is the impact of the extended operating temperature range?

A: The SM05T1G operates from -55°C to 150°C, compared to the CSL05D BK's -50°C to 125°C range. This extended range provides additional thermal margin for applications in extreme environments and improves long-term reliability in high-temperature conditions.
